    Hopefully a more straightforward question than my last thread....

    Somehow I appear to be missing any wiring for a radio in my Mk2. I suspect I may have removed it unintentionally when I first took the wiring loom out of the car 2 years ago.

    So my question is simply, what wires am I going to need to add and where will I connect them to the fusebox? I have wiring for speakers run already but nothing beyond that.

    Help is much appreciated.

    the speaker wiring is seperate from main wiring, if thats all gone might be easier to strip it all out of a donor in scrappy. well I say easy...

    for the power plug this is all tapped into the middle harness on the CE1 unplug the big black connector and pull it out for an easier life. the live is tapped into the ciggy lighter, the earth goes to a spade plug near the ciggy lighter then off to a stud on the A pillar or sometimes just direct. there is an illumination grey/blue as well but modern radio dont use it.

    There wont be an ignition live as standard, you can tap that to the glovebox light look for a 2 pin plug with black/red wire near the big black plug its there even on poverty spec without the glovebox light

    Cheers for that. Might be worth mentioning that I have the dash out at the moment so won't really be difficult to just run new wiring to the fusebox.

    For live and ignition live can I just use the G and P spades on the back of the fusebox?

    sure can, though P are unfused so ideally you want to tap to radio like original or add an inline fuse of your own :)
